Output 64843e4d18397a325fb6c23bac1751348f4899ba63b10bc9f5377b6f1fa096aa:17

value
1560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8df22caadba239feb824a0c722621c848135997 OP_EQUAL
address
3H5vkXSt9fMUqsiNw7MCofBYXyi2yzrTeF
transaction
64843e4d18397a325fb6c23bac1751348f4899ba63b10bc9f5377b6f1fa096aa
spent
true